Role Purpose
Lead and develop a high-performing maintenance team to ensure equipment reliability, regulatory compliance, and continuous improvement in a 24/7 food manufacturing environment. Champion continuous improvement methodologies to drive operational excellence and support Ben & Jerry’s social, product, and economic missions. A key focus of this role is achieving high OTIF (On Time In Full) performance for Preventive Maintenance tasks, ensuring maintenance activities are completed as scheduled to maximize machine efficiency, reliability, and production readiness.
Key Responsibilities
Team Leadership & Development
Supervise Mechanical & Electrical Technicians, Stockroom Attendants, and Maintenance Planners.
Develop shift structures, vacation schedules, succession plans, and training programs.
Conduct recruiting, interviewing, onboarding, and skill gap analysis (Skill Matrix).
Spend 75% of time on the shop floor (6/2 rule) to coach and guide technicians.
Maintenance Operations
Plan and execute preventive, predictive, and corrective maintenance using CMMS.
Ensure completion of PMs, F-tags, and AM tasks with quality and timeliness.
Validate Autonomous Maintenance standards and partner with FLMs for compliance.
Lead root cause analysis and execute EWOs for breakdowns >4 hours.
Maintain 5S standards in maintenance areas and storerooms.
Continuous Improvement & Projects
Champion continuous improvement initiatives across maintenance operations.
Identify and implement cost-saving strategies and low-cost maintenance solutions.
Collaborate with Engineering on innovation projects, line modifications, and new installations.
Document Maintenance Improvements and communicate with Engineering.
Lead projects including rebuilds, upgrades, and new equipment installations.
Compliance & Safety
Ensure adherence to OSHA, HACCP, FDA, PSM, and other regulatory standards.
Train new hires on certified safety procedures and SHE policies.
Investigate incidents and implement CAPAs.
Ensure MOC compliance for equipment changes impacting food safety.
Systems & Budget Management
Track labor costs, overtime, and absences via Kronos.
Maintain accurate maintenance records and logs.
Cross-Functional Collaboration
Align with Production, Quality, and Engineering teams to optimize downtime usage.
Coordinate maintenance activities during product trials, commissioning, and seasonal shifts.
Support site security and vendor management.
QualificationsRequired
Bachelor’s degree in Mechanical, Electrical, or Industrial Engineering (or equivalent experience).
3–5 years of industrial maintenance experience, preferably in food manufacturing.
Proven supervisory experience in a unionized environment.
Strong communication, leadership, and organizational skills.
Proficiency in CMMS, Microsoft Office, and maintenance analytics.
Preferred
Certifications: CMRP, Six Sigma, Lean Manufacturing.
Experience with sanitary design, HACCP, and food-grade maintenance practices.
Familiarity with predictive maintenance technologies (vibration, thermal, ultrasonic).
Work Environment
24/7 manufacturing operation requiring flexibility across shifts.
Frequent time on the shop floor with exposure to factory conditions.
Use of PPE and compliance with safety protocols required.
